原文:用commander.js構建自己的腳手架工具

隨着前端技術的發展,工程化逐漸成為了一種趨勢。但在實際開發時,搭建項目是一件很繁瑣的事情,尤其是在對一個框架的用法還不熟悉的時候。於是很多框架都自帶一套腳手架工具,在初始化前端項目的時候就可以不用自己從頭搭建,只要在命令行輸入初始化命令即可。 那么,如果想自行開發出這樣一個命令行工具來初始化自定義項目,該怎么做呢 研究的過程中,偶然間發現了commander.js這個模塊,可以幫助命令行工具的開發 ...

2019-04-02 15:30 0 722 推薦指數:

查看詳情

手把手教你搭建腳手架工具 - (commander)

隨着Nodejs的不斷發展,對於前端來說要做的東西也就更多,vue腳手架react腳手架等等等一系列的東西都脫穎而出,進入到人們的視野當中,對於這些腳手架工具來講也只是停留在應用階段,從來沒有想過腳手架是如何實現的?vue init webpack 項目名稱是如何通過這樣的命令創建了一個項目 ...

Tue Nov 24 02:07:00 CST 2020 0 446
Vue.js 介紹及其腳手架工具搭建

vue.js介紹 (MVVM、核心思想) vue.js 是一套輕量級的 MVVM 的漸進式框架。Vue 的核心庫只關注視圖層。vue.js 的官方網址是:點我,我是網址 MVVM 介紹 MVVM 全稱是 Model - ViewModel - View 的簡稱。 Model 對應 ...

Thu Apr 13 02:02:00 CST 2017 0 2298
React快速構建腳手架

1、create-react-app 優點: 無需配置:官方的配置堪稱完美,幾乎不用你再配置任何東西,就可以上開發項目。 高集成性:集成了對React,JSX,ES6和Flow的支持。 自帶服務:集成了開發服務器,你可以實現開發預覽一體化。 熱更新:保存自動更新,讓你的開發 ...

Thu Mar 15 23:02:00 CST 2018 0 1665
搭建自己的cli腳手架工具

cli本質就是一個nodejs項目,因此創建一個nodejs項目即可。 在package.json中加入bin配置,例如: 然后執行npm link就可以注冊到全局Path用於調試了(可以通過命令行鍵入yulan了,實際會執行yulan后面對應的./src/index.js ...

Sun Jun 14 16:28:00 CST 2020 1 533
Node 命令行工具 commander.js 快速上

完整的 node.js 命令行解決方案。 tj/commander.js: node.js command-line interfaces made easy 中文文檔 1 只使用 option 這個是最簡單和好理解的,直接使用看官方的例子即可: commander.js ...

Tue Nov 30 01:58:00 CST 2021 0 937
腳手架vue-cli系列二:vue-cli的工程模板與構建工具

上篇文章我們提到了vue-cli的工程模板。這里我們來詳細的進行介紹。 vue-cli提供的腳手架只是一個最基礎的,也可以說是Vue團隊認為的工程結構的一種最佳實踐。對於初學者或者以前曾從事AngularJS/React開發的用戶來說,可能對開發環境有自已習慣性用法和熟悉的工具,但我建議用Vue ...

Thu Sep 27 20:58:00 CST 2018 0 1257
使用 .NET CLI 構建項目腳手架

前言 在微服務場景中,開發人員分配到不同的小組,系統會拆分為很多個微服務,有一點是,每個項目都需要單元測試,接口文檔,WebAPI接口等,創建新項目這些都是重復的工作,而且還要保證各個項目結構的大體一致,這時就需要一個適用於企業內部的框架模板,類似於前端的腳手架,可以做到開箱即用,注重業務 ...

Wed Mar 10 03:45:00 CST 2021 1 657
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M